Alright my DD mrs. 245K on the odometer needs help. last week it died while warming up to chauffer me to work. I started it again noticed that it was at its halfway mark on the temp let out on the clutch and psst she just died. I parked it and drove my civic to work. I worked on it this weekend cleaned the egr, cleaned the nasty gummy throttle body (which I thought either one could of been it)after driving it and noticed if I pressed in the clutch the rpms drop absurdly fast and doesn't even attempt to idle. If I start it up after dieing it will idle and occassionally die. It finally kicked a code after letting it idle numerous times after restarting. I believe I am using the right port as you may have guessed I am a novice to Preludes and Accords I am extremely handy with civics, integras, and the like though. The port I found was in the center under the radio same 2-pin used in the civics that makes the abs light go off and blinks the cel. It kicked code 4 it is obd1 and I found that to be the crank angle sensor. Does this sound like the likely culprit?

after taking off the valve cover to check my timing I see that my exhaust cam is retarded about 1 tooth +/-. Is it true that since my crank angle sensor is in my dizzy that it will trip the crank sensor code?
I can answer that, YES, the sensor is in the distrib. I have never had the top off the cams, so I can't tell you anything there. I do have a top end overhaul on mine coming in the next few months as I have 250K miles as well.
